WebPortfolio beta is equal to the covariance of the portfolio returns and market returns, divided by the variance of market returns. We can calculate the numerator, or covariance of portfolio and market returns, with cov (portfolio_returns_xts_rebalanced_monthly, market_returns_tidy$returns) and the denominator with var (market_return$returns). WebThe beta metric for a portfolio with respect to a pre-defined index, called X, captures the sensitivity of the fund to X. Basically, the fund’s beta to X tries to capture how much money the fund makes as X goes up (or down) by a specified amount.
